Rajkumar Bhogen Singh

Rajkumar Bhogen Singh was one of the youngest actors to win the Sangeet Natak Akademi award.

Rajkumar Bhogen Singh was a prominent theatre personality who born in the year of 1958. He won Sangeet Natak Akademi award at very young age i.e. at the age of 39. He began his career in Manipuri theatre under Ratan Thiyam after acquiring substantial knowledge of indigenous narrative forms like Wari Liba, and utilized them as an actor`s resource in over thirty productions directed by Thiyam. He gained much international exposure. In many places like in Greece, Italy, France, Japan, Thailand, Rajkumar Bhogen Singh acted as lead actor and administrator of Thiyam`s Chorus Repertory Theatre.
